summaryrefslogtreecommitdiffstats
path: root/sys/kern/kern_kthread.c
diff options
context:
space:
mode:
authordelphij <delphij@FreeBSD.org>2012-05-11 23:43:32 +0000
committerdelphij <delphij@FreeBSD.org>2012-05-11 23:43:32 +0000
commit53e510d1ef1e46c3ef612a1287ee44054087a064 (patch)
tree63662dcd5eba7b1d8bf0732b7cd8c563a66fca23 /sys/kern/kern_kthread.c
parentf7e33a4a6727a73bddfbb372811d162be5d03bec (diff)
downloadFreeBSD-src-53e510d1ef1e46c3ef612a1287ee44054087a064.zip
FreeBSD-src-53e510d1ef1e46c3ef612a1287ee44054087a064.tar.gz
Revert previous revision, misunderstood the code :(
Diffstat (limited to 'sys/kern/kern_kthread.c')
-rw-r--r--sys/kern/kern_kthread.c1
1 files changed, 0 insertions, 1 deletions
diff --git a/sys/kern/kern_kthread.c b/sys/kern/kern_kthread.c
index 53bfc07..9dcdeb0 100644
--- a/sys/kern/kern_kthread.c
+++ b/sys/kern/kern_kthread.c
@@ -182,7 +182,6 @@ kproc_suspend(struct proc *p, int timo)
return (EINVAL);
}
SIGADDSET(p->p_siglist, SIGSTOP);
- PROC_UNLOCK(p);
wakeup(p);
return msleep(&p->p_siglist, &p->p_mtx, PPAUSE | PDROP, "suspkp", timo);
}
OpenPOWER on IntegriCloud